Short answer: No. Details: It's a dinner show. They are one and the same. Together. We just got back from Gat/PF and that was one of the *most funnest* things we did all week... There are add-ons that are entirely optional(((yeah yeah we bought the entrance pic they take of you walking in & posing with moonshine and a shotgun, AND the extra bells, AND the extra flags, AND the extra beers LOL))) yet so very worth it to our ext fam of 9... The meal itself: Fried chicken, pulled pork, corn coblets, mashed taters, cole slaw, biscuits, sweet tea, and banana or chocolate puddin was pretty good And served on old timey plates. It's brought out at the pre-show and truly not enough time to eat leisurely. But still worth it as part of the *Dinner Show* experience. Many of the cast are also servers. The show and dinner are priced together. Cannot do just the show. You can get a $5 off coupon code online though and don't use groupon to purchase them because you will pay more. Childrens tickets on groupon have a good discount though.
